Sash Window Renovation Near Me: An In-Depth Guide
Sash windows are an ultimate feature of numerous historic and modern homes. Their elegant style and functionality improve the aesthetic appeal of a home while using light, ventilation, and a link to the architectural past. However, like any feature of a residential or commercial property, sash windows need maintenance, and sometimes, renovation. If you're considering refreshing your sash windows, this detailed guide will walk you through what to anticipate and how to find sash window renovation services nearby.
Understanding Sash WindowsWhat are Sash Windows?
Sash windows consist of several movable panels, or "sashes," that hold glass and are traditionally designed to move vertically or horizontally. They're typically made from lumber and can be available in numerous styles, including:
Single-hung: Only the leading sash is repaired, while the bottom sash can move.Double-hung: Both sashes can move, enabling for more air flow control.Moving sash: Both sashes move horizontally.Benefits of Renovating Sash Windows
Remodeling sash windows can yield many advantages:
Improved Energy Efficiency: Older windows might not be well-sealed, resulting in considerable energy loss. Renovation can include insulation and weather condition stripping.Enhanced Aesthetics: Restoring wooden frames and changing old glazing can refresh the appearance of your residential or commercial property.Conservation of Historical Value: Renovating original features preserves the character of period homes, typically valued in areas with stringent architectural standards.Increased Property Value: Well-maintained sash windows can boost a home's market price.Key Aspects of Sash Window RenovationTypical Renovation Tasks
When seeking sash window renovation services, it's crucial to know what specific jobs might be consisted of in the service. Here prevail renovation treatments:
Sash Replacement: Damaged or weakened sashes are replaced with new, traditionally suitable materials.Painting & & Finishing: New coats of paint and finishing can secure the wood and enhance appearance.Weather Stripping: Adding or changing weather condition removing to improve insulation and decrease drafts.Glazing Repair: Replacing damaged glass and re-sealing existing glazing to avoid leakages.Balancing Weights: Ensuring that the counterweights in double-hung windows are functioning correctly for smooth operation.The Renovation Process
The sash window renovation procedure usually includes numerous phases:
Assessment: A professional will assess the condition of the windows.Quote: A quote covering the scope of work and costs is offered.Preparation: Protecting surrounding areas and gathering needed materials.Renovation Work: Performing the renovation tasks, which may last from a couple of hours to numerous days, depending on the extent of the work.Finishing Touches: Final inspections and painting or sealing to complete the job.JobTime EstimateCost EstimateSash Replacement1-2 days₤ 200 - ₤ 600 per sashPainting & & Finishing1-3 days₤ 150 - ₤ 400Weather Stripping1 day₤ 50 - ₤ 150Glazing Repair1-2 days₤ 100 - ₤ 300Balancing WeightsA couple of hours₤ 50 - ₤ 120Discovering Sash Window Renovation Services Near You

Get QuotesNumerous Estimates: Reach out to different contractors for quotes to compare rates and services provided.Ask Detailed Questions: Ensure the estimates describe what is included in the service to prevent any covert costs.Frequently Asked Questions about Sash Window RenovationQ1: How frequently should sash windows be remodelled?
A1: Renovation needs can differ; however, it's advisable to examine sash windows every 5-10 years, specifically if they're exposed to severe weather.
Q2: Can I DIY sash window renovation?
A2: Some minor repairs can be DIY, such as painting; however, significant renovations, especially involving structural parts, are best left to specialists.
Q3: How much does sash window renovation generally cost?
A3: Costs can vary based upon the extent of the work needed, however fundamental renovations can vary from a couple of hundred to several thousand dollars.
Q4: Will renovating my sash windows enhance home insulation?
A4: Yes, correct renovation can significantly improve insulation, particularly when attending to spaces and using contemporary weatherproofing strategies.
Q5: Are there any grants offered for renovating historical windows?
A5: In some areas, there may be local or nationwide grants readily available for preserving historic functions. It's rewarding to talk to city government or heritage companies.
